Morson Group is recruiting an FP&A Manager to join our aerospace client in Wolverhampton on a 6‑month on-site contract.
The role requires partnership with senior finance and site leadership to drive performance, budgeting, forecasting and cost management.
You will lead a finance team, develop financial models, and support strategic initiatives, with emphasis on margin expansion and operational improvement.
